Zelensky on the importance of support from partnerspublished at 08:24
President of Ukraine Volodymyr Zelensky noted that "the cessation of killings is a key element in stopping the war," emphasizing the need for pressure from Russia in the process of peace negotiations.
In a statement published on social media, he expressed that Russia is not responding to the clear calls for a ceasefire and did not specify when it plans to stop military actions that complicate the situation.
In the joint statement of the leaders of the Nordic-Baltic cooperation, which includes Denmark, Estonia, Finland, Iceland, Latvia, Lithuania, Norway, and Sweden, it is emphasized that "Putin cannot be trusted." They reaffirmed their unwavering support for Ukraine, stressing the importance of peace regulation and providing security guarantees.
The leaders of the cooperation stated that "to achieve a just and lasting peace, the next step must be cooperation with Ukraine." They also called for the return of children abducted from occupied territories and for the liberation of military personnel.
Zelensky thanked the Nordic-Baltic cooperation for their support, noting that all points mentioned in the statement are important for achieving lasting peace. He also emphasized the necessity of closer coordination with international partners in preparation for a meeting with U.S. President Donald Trump.
